Glioblastoma (GBM) cultured tumoroids are three-dimensional microtumor models derived from patient glioblastoma samples, cultured under conditions that preserve the tumor's native architecture, genetic profile, and cellular heterogeneity. These tumoroids replicate critical features of GBM such as invasiveness, therapy resistance, and neural stem-like cell populations.

Unlike traditional 2D cultures, GBM tumoroids maintain hypoxic gradients, stemness, and extracellular matrix interactions, making them ideal for evaluating targeted therapies, radiation sensitivity, and tumor-stroma interactions.
